1. Living Room – A Space That Welcomes Emotion
A low-profile cream linen sofa is paired with a round wooden coffee table and a neutral-toned handwoven rug. Matte white walls are accented with canvas artwork and soft spot lighting. A built-in TV unit integrated with bookshelves keeps the design minimal while maintaining a warm, inviting atmosphere.
2. Kitchen – Compact, Refined, and Functional
The L-shaped kitchen features light wood-grain laminate cabinetry and a white stone countertop with subtle veining. Integrated handle-less doors and full-height cabinets optimize storage. A compact four-seat dining set is complemented by handmade ceramic pendant lights in earthy tones, adding softness and a sense of intimacy.
3. Bedroom – A Place for Complete Rest
The bed is upholstered in beige fabric with a gently curved, rounded headboard. Built-in wardrobes with flat, handle-less doors maintain a clean look. A small vanity with a full-length mirror is paired with a light gray accent chair. Warm ambient lighting creates a soothing and restful atmosphere.
4. Relaxation & Home Office Corner
A small corner by the window is designed for reading or working from home, featuring a compact wall-mounted desk, soft fabric chair, and a mini bookshelf. Natural light combined with greenery ensures the space remains functional while evoking comfort and emotion.
5. Décor & Materials
The entire space is finished with eco-friendly materials, including E1-standard engineered wood, cotton fabrics, engineered stone, ceramics, and clear glass. Every detail is simplified yet thoughtfully refined—true to the “less but better” philosophy.
